Backup Copy next interval display

Post by philfreund » 1 person likes this post

Is there any way to see when the next interval for a running job will start? I have several backup copy jobs that run run either once per week or every 2 days. I would like to be able to see when the next interval will start to make sure the interval is setup correctly.

Re: Backup Copy next interval display

Post by stamm »

And another vote from me for this feature. I run several air-gap backup copies on a monthly basis, and the only way I know to bring the repositories online for this purpose is when the copy jobs fail since they have nowhere to copy the data! That's the signal to activate the repos and re-run the copy jobs. The jobs finish, I offline the repos, then wait for the failure messages the following month to do it all over again. It's not a huge deal but knowing precisely when the copies will run would be great.

Re: Backup Copy next interval display

Post by foggy » 1 person likes this post

I'm not saying about pre-job script in Veeam B&R. You could just look at the copy interval start time configured in the job and schedule the script to run, say, 15 minutes prior to that via Windows Task Scheduler (independently from the job).
